首页
/ 打破企业数据壁垒:n8n实现跨系统智能同步的实战指南

打破企业数据壁垒:n8n实现跨系统智能同步的实战指南

2026-04-12 09:32:12作者:裘晴惠Vivianne

当你需要整合CRM、ERP和电商平台的客户数据时,是否经历过这样的困境:IT团队排期需要3周,数据导出导入耗费8小时,关键客户信息因同步延迟导致营销活动错失良机?在数字化转型加速的今天,企业平均使用11.6个业务系统,却有73%的组织仍依赖人工或脚本进行数据同步,这不仅造成资源浪费,更让实时决策成为空谈。

本文将通过"问题发现→解决方案→价值验证"的三段式框架,带你用n8n构建企业级数据同步系统,实现跨平台数据无缝流动,让技术团队从重复劳动中解放,聚焦真正的业务创新。

一、破解数据孤岛难题:企业数据同步的核心痛点

企业数据流动不畅如同城市交通系统缺乏立交桥,各系统数据如同行驶在独立道路上的车辆,难以高效汇合。这种数据孤岛主要表现为三种典型症状:

1.1 系统语言障碍:数据格式的"巴别塔"困境

不同业务系统采用迥异的数据标准:CRM中的客户生日字段格式为"YYYY/MM/DD",而ERP系统要求"DD-MM-YYYY";电商平台的地址信息存储为单行文本,财务系统却需要拆分为省、市、区等独立字段。这种格式差异导致直接数据导入时错误率高达38%,相当于每1000条记录就有380条需要人工修正。

1.2 流程断裂:数据同步的"断崖式"体验

传统同步方案往往是静态的定时任务,无法响应业务实时需求。某连锁零售企业曾因商品库存数据每日仅同步一次,导致线上显示"有货"但线下实际缺货的情况,单日损失达12万元。更复杂的是,当同步过程中出现异常时,缺乏有效的错误处理机制,往往需要技术人员手动介入排查,平均恢复时间超过4小时。

1.3 资源消耗:数据搬运的"人力黑洞"

某中型制造企业IT团队每周需花费16小时编写临时脚本,处理不同系统间的数据导出、转换和导入。这些工作不仅占用开发资源,更因缺乏版本控制和文档,导致系统维护成本逐年攀升。调查显示,企业平均每年在数据同步相关工作上投入的人力成本占IT总预算的19%,相当于每年损失近五分之一的技术创新潜力。

二、构建智能数据高速公路:n8n同步方案实现指南

n8n作为开源的工作流自动化平台,提供了构建数据同步高速公路的全套工具。其核心优势在于将复杂的ETL(抽取-转换-加载)流程可视化、模块化,让非技术人员也能搭建企业级数据管道。

2.1 准备工作:环境搭建与核心概念

环境部署(3种方式任选):

  • Docker快速启动(推荐):
    docker volume create n8n_data
    docker run -it --rm --name n8n -p 5678:5678 -v n8n_data:/home/node/.n8n docker.n8nio/n8n
    
  • 源码部署
    git clone https://gitcode.com/GitHub_Trending/n8/n8n
    cd n8n
    pnpm install
    pnpm run start
    
  • 云服务:直接使用n8n官方托管服务,适合快速验证需求

核心概念解析

n8n的数据同步能力基于三个核心组件构建,如同高速公路系统的三大要素:

  • 触发器(Trigger):相当于高速公路的入口收费站,监控数据源变化(如"当新订单创建时"、"每小时检查一次数据更新")
  • 节点(Nodes):类似高速公路上的服务区和立交桥,处理数据转换、过滤和路由
  • 工作流(Workflow):完整的高速公路路线图,定义数据从源头到目标的完整路径

n8n工作流编辑器界面 图1:n8n工作流编辑器界面,展示了GitHub触发器与Slack通知的条件分支逻辑

2.2 执行步骤:三阶段构建客户数据同步管道

以"电商订单→CRM客户信息→ERP库存更新"的典型业务场景为例,完整实现跨系统数据同步:

阶段1:数据抽取——构建多源数据接入层

目标:从不同系统获取原始数据,建立统一接入点

  1. 添加触发节点

    • 电商平台:选择"Webhook"节点,配置接收新订单的POST端点
    • CRM系统:使用"定时触发器",设置每小时查询新增客户
    • 数据库:添加"MySQL"节点,配置查询库存变动的SQL语句
  2. 配置认证信息

    • API密钥:在各系统创建专用API凭证,n8n的凭证管理系统会加密存储
    • 数据库连接:使用JDBC连接字符串,支持SSH隧道加密传输

故障排查提示:若连接失败,先检查:

  • API端点是否支持外部访问(可通过Postman测试)
  • 防火墙设置是否允许n8n服务器IP
  • 认证凭证是否具备足够权限(建议使用最小权限原则)

阶段2:数据转换——建立标准化处理中心

目标:将不同来源的数据转换为统一格式,消除"语言障碍"

  1. 字段映射与清洗

    • 使用"数据转换"节点,将电商平台的"buyer_email"映射为CRM的"customer_email"
    • 添加"函数"节点,编写JavaScript代码标准化日期格式:
      return {
        standardized_date: new Date(item.original_date).toISOString().split('T')[0]
      };
      
    • 通过"过滤"节点移除重复记录(基于唯一标识字段如客户ID)
  2. 数据验证与增强

    • 配置"验证"节点,检查必填字段完整性(如客户手机号格式)
    • 调用"AI助手"节点,自动补全缺失的客户信息(如根据邮箱域名推测公司名称)

n8n的数据处理引擎采用事件驱动架构,如同智能交通系统,能根据数据量自动调节处理能力。核心处理逻辑位于workflow/src/目录,采用流处理模式确保数据实时性。

阶段3:数据加载——实现智能分发与异常处理

目标:将处理后的数据准确写入目标系统,并建立错误处理机制

  1. 多目标系统写入

    • 配置"CRM"节点,使用UPSERT操作(存在则更新,不存在则创建)
    • 添加"ERP"节点,触发库存扣减API
    • 连接"Google Sheets"节点,生成每日订单报表
  2. 构建异常处理流程

    • 添加"IF"条件节点,判断数据写入是否成功
    • 失败路径:连接"Slack"节点发送错误通知,包含详细日志
    • 重试机制:对临时网络错误配置自动重试(最多3次,每次间隔5分钟)

n8n高级工作流示例 图2:包含AI Agent和条件分支的高级工作流,支持复杂业务逻辑处理

2.3 验证方法:确保同步系统可靠性

部署后通过三种方式验证系统有效性:

  1. 数据一致性检查

    • 随机抽取100条记录,对比源系统与目标系统数据
    • 检查时间戳字段,确认同步延迟不超过30秒
  2. 异常场景测试

    • 模拟API服务不可用,验证错误通知和自动重试功能
    • 提交不完整数据,测试验证规则是否生效
  3. 性能压力测试

    • 使用n8n的"循环"节点创建1000条测试数据
    • 监控系统资源使用情况,确保CPU占用不超过70%

三、价值验证:从成本节约到业务赋能

3.1 量化收益:数据同步效率提升分析

某中型电商企业实施n8n数据同步方案后,获得显著业务收益:

指标 传统方案 n8n方案 提升幅度
同步开发周期 7-10天 1-2天 80%
日常维护时间 16小时/周 2小时/周 87.5%
数据同步延迟 4-24小时 <30秒 99.8%
错误处理效率 4小时/次 5分钟/次 97.9%

表1:传统数据同步方案与n8n方案的关键指标对比

3.2 业务价值案例:从效率工具到决策支持

案例:某连锁餐饮企业的供应链数据同步

该企业面临三大痛点:门店销售数据与中央仓库库存不同步导致缺货、供应商结算数据分散在多个Excel中、新品上市时各系统商品信息需手动更新。

通过n8n构建的同步系统实现:

  • 销售数据实时同步至库存系统,缺货预警响应时间从24小时缩短至15分钟
  • 供应商发票自动匹配订单数据,财务对账时间减少75%
  • 新品信息一次录入,自动同步至POS、电商和库存系统,上市时间提前3天

实施6个月后,该企业库存周转天数从45天降至32天,运营成本降低18%,客户满意度提升23%。

3.3 常见误区澄清

在数据同步项目实施中,企业常陷入以下误区:

  1. "追求大而全":首次实施就尝试同步所有系统,导致复杂度失控。建议从2-3个核心系统的关键数据开始,逐步扩展。

  2. "忽视数据治理":只关注技术实现,忽略数据质量标准。应在项目初期建立数据字典和清洗规则,避免" garbage in, garbage out"。

  3. "低估监控重要性":部署后缺乏持续监控,无法及时发现同步异常。建议配置关键指标告警,如同步成功率低于99.5%时自动通知管理员。

四、进阶方向与行动建议

4.1 三个进阶使用方向

  1. 预测性同步:结合AI预测节点,根据历史数据趋势提前同步可能需要的数据,如电商大促前预加载商品信息。

  2. 数据血缘追踪:使用n8n的元数据功能,记录每个数据字段的来源和转换历史,满足合规审计要求。

  3. 跨组织数据共享:通过加密的Webhook和权限控制,安全地与合作伙伴共享特定数据,如供应商实时查看其产品库存。

4.2 行动召唤

企业数据同步能力已成为数字化竞争的关键要素。根据Forrester研究,有效的数据集成策略可使企业决策速度提升35%,运营成本降低22%。立即行动:

  1. 评估:列出你企业中最耗时的数据同步任务,计算当前人力成本
  2. 试点:选择本文介绍的客户数据同步场景,用n8n构建POC(概念验证)
  3. 扩展:基于试点经验,制定企业级数据同步路线图

n8n的开源特性确保你无需受制于商业软件的许可限制,其模块化设计让系统可以随业务需求灵活扩展。现在就访问项目仓库,开始构建你的企业数据高速公路。

记住:在数据驱动的时代,流动的数据创造价值,停滞的数据成为负担。选择正确的工具,让数据为业务增长加速。

登录后查看全文
热门项目推荐
相关项目推荐